Auto crop support added to Command Line and Docker solutions.RAW files must be opened through Adobe Camera RAW and loaded into Photoshop to be accessible to Perfectly Clear. Monochrome and CMYK images must be converted to RGB before using Perfectly Clear. Any image file that Photoshop or Lightroom can open and convert to this format may be used in Perfectly Clear. Perfectly Clear requires RGB-formatted images in either 8 or 16-bit color depth.
